Mille Lacs Band Gaming Regulatory Authority (GRA)
The Mille Lacs Band Gaming Regulatory Authority (GRA) is an independent regulatory agency of tribal government established to separate the government’s regulatory function from the management function. The purpose of the GRA is to ensure that all gaming activities on Mille Lacs Band land are carried out in compliance with the Indian Gaming Regulatory Act, Title 15 of the Mille Lacs Band statutes, tribal and state compacts, the GRA’s Detailed Gaming Regulations (DGR), and all other applicable laws.
